Bart and Homer were wandering in the forest when they set a trap to catch a rabbit, involving a leaf and a tree bent almost double. The rabbit came along and started eating the leaf, only for the tree to snap back violently. This catapulted the rabbit over a hundred feet into the air and (more than likely) killed it.
